Mohun Bagan Super Giant secured a spot in the Durand Cup 2026 final after a tense penalty shootout victory against NorthEast United. The win sets the stage for a massive Kolkata Derby in the summit clash.

  • Mohun Bagan won the penalty shootout 4-3.
  • Goalkeeper Vishal Kaith emerged as the hero with two crucial saves.
  • A highly anticipated Kolkata Derby will take place in the final.
  • Mohun Bagan is chasing a record-extending 18th Durand Cup title.

In a high-octane semifinal clash held at the Jawaharlal Nehru Stadium in Shillong, Mohun Bagan Super Giant (MBSG) overcame NorthEast United FC (NEUFC) in a nail-biting penalty shootout to secure their place in the Durand Cup 2026 final. After a scoreless 90 minutes where both defenses stood tall, the match was decided from the spot, with the Mariners showing immense composure to win 4-3.

The Heroics of Vishal Kaith

The match was a tactical battle of attrition, with neither side able to break the deadlock during regulation time. However, the spotlight shifted entirely to Vishal Kaith during the penalty shootout. The goalkeeper became the architect of Mohun Bagan's success by saving two consecutive penalties, effectively breaking the spirit of the Highlanders and sealing the victory for the Kolkata giants.

Setting the Stage for a Kolkata Derby

The result has guaranteed a blockbuster final for football enthusiasts. The Durand Cup 2026 summit clash will feature a repeat of the legendary Kolkata Derby, as Mohun Bagan prepares to face their arch-rivals, East Bengal. This echoes the 2023 edition, promising an atmosphere of intense rivalry and unparalleled passion in the final match.

Did You Know?: Mohun Bagan holds the record for the most Durand Cup titles, having won the trophy 17 times.
